LS variable metadata

CGHH21
TableME21 2021 Census - LS members
Short descriptionCarers in household and their general health. 2021.
Source2021 Census. Question P21 and P24.
Code notes1-7, -6 Missing, -9 No code required (Communal Establishment, No person household).

Variable coding

ValueLabel
1No carers in household
2One carer in household: Very good health
3One carer in household: Good health
4One carer in household: Fair health
5One carer in household: Bad health
6One carer in household: Very bad health
7Two or more carers in household
-6Missing
-9No code required (Communal Establishment, No person household)

descriptionThis derived variable describes how many carers there are in the household, by their general health.
codedas
source2021 Census. Question P21 and P24.
derivedY
codelistY
notesAn unpaid carer may look after, give help or support to anyone who has long-term physical or mental ill-health conditions, illness or problems related to old age. This does not include any activities as part of paid employment. This help can be within or outside of the carer's household. A person's assessment of the general state of their health from very good to very bad. This assessment is not based on a person's health over any specified period of time.
